They report up to three hours to cross Santa Teresa to Juárez

City of Juarez.- Lines up to four miles and waits of over three hours signal users to cross from Santa Teresa, New Mexico to Jerónimo, Chihuahua.

“Don’t even take revenge, I’ve been there for three hours and I haven’t crossed Juárez,” said a social network user.

Others have complained of bullies who have entered the ranks.

Friday was the last day of school in the Texas and New Mexico school districts, so thousands of paisanos families cross the border to visit Mexican territory.

The crossings to Mexico are long with more than an hour of waiting to cross Juárez in the different ports of the region.
